WebMINIMIZE SWIRL MARKS. Minimize swirl by maintaining clean buffing pads. Spur wool pads frequently, wash and air dry occasionally. Soak foam pads in warm water and ring dry. Never put in dryer. WebNov 11, 2024 · 1. Mechanical Polishing. This polishing method is based on the plastic deformation or cutting of the surface of the material. It then obtains a smooth surface finish by removing polished convexities. WebThe wheel should be spinning away from an edge and not towards it. Buffing against the direction the wheel is spinning will cut quicker, buffing with the direction of the wheel will give a smoother finish.
